13 On June 6, 2024, the court, the Honorable Susan van Keulen presiding, issued an Order
14 || Denying Plaintiff's Application to Proceed in Forma Pauperis. Specifically, the court ordered © 15 || Plaintiff Malik M. Justin to either “(1) file a renewed application or (2) pay the filing fee” by Q 16 || July 8, 2024. See ECF 4. The court warned Mr. Justin that the failure to complete either task by
= 17 || the deadline may result in dismissal of this action. /d. The time for Mr. Justin to act has passed,
18 || and he has failed to complete either task. 19 The Court possesses the inherent power to dismiss an action of its own accord “to achieve 20 || the orderly and expeditious disposition of cases.” Link v. Wabash R.R. Co., 370 U.S. 626, 629-33 21 || (1962). By July 31, 2024, Mr. Justin shall file a written response to this order explaining why this 22 || action should not be dismissed for his failure to prosecute his case and to comply with court 23 || orders. If Mr. Justin fails to respond to this order by the July 31, 2024 deadline, the Court will 24 || dismiss the action without prejudice for failure to prosecute and to comply with court orders. 25 IT IS SO ORDERED. 26 Dated: July 16, 2024 □ 27 col. 28 ARACELI MARTINEZ-OLGUIN United States District Judge
